quasigeostrophic equations

The system of momentum and thermodynamic equations, derived through the quasigeostrophic approximation, that fulfill the requirements of quasigeostrophic theory.
At the momentum level and using the pseudoheight coordinate z = [1 - (p/p0)κ]cpθ0/g the equations are
